My latest aquisition, help and comments invited.
 
4 Attachment(s)
Last purchase of 2025, sold as a Regency era British sword but not finding much about it. Brass hilt, fish skin covered grip and a straight single edged and fullered blade. Unmarked or stamped though the blade is not in the best state so might have just worn away :( ! Scabbard is black lacquered brass. Overall a decent piece and feels good in hand.
